Detour (2016) - A Riveting Drama Exploring Choices and Consequences
"Detour" is a 2016 Hollywood drama film that delves deep into themes of fate, troubled pasts, and the choices that define our lives. Centered on the lives of two young men whose paths cross in the most unexpected way, the film is a poignant exploration of pain, redemption, and the human need for connection. Directed by the talented Christopher Smith, "Detour" stands out as a gripping narrative that combines intense performances with a tightly woven screenplay.
Plot Summary
The story revolves around Jack Hammond (played by Tye Sheridan), a shy and introverted young man burdened by a troubled past and haunted by his mistakes. To escape his problems, Jack flees home and ends up hitchhiking down a lonely road. Along this desolate route, he encounters Harper (portrayed by Emory Cohen), a charismatic and seemingly carefree man who quickly offers Jack a ride.
The initial encounter between Jack and Harper appears to be a chance meeting; however, the film gradually reveals the complex layers beneath Harper's personality and his own struggles. As the two embark on this road trip, the journey becomes not just a physical passage but a metaphorical one — confronting inner demons, secrets, and the confrontation of personal grief.
The narrative unfolds with tension and suspense, weaving through moments of camaraderie, vulnerability, and danger. As they navigate through the rural landscapes and secluded roads, the film invites viewers to contemplate the repercussions of choices made under duress and the unexpected ways in which people can find solace or destruction in one another.

Director and Writer
"Detour" is directed by Christopher Smith, a filmmaker known for his mastery in blending thriller elements with strong character-driven narratives. Smith’s direction ensures that the film maintains a tight atmosphere throughout, carefully balancing the pace between quiet introspection and moments of dramatic intensity.
The screenplay, written by Christopher Smith himself, showcases his ability to craft a story that is both suspenseful and emotionally resonant. Through sharp dialogue and carefully developed characters, Smith invites the audience to engage with themes of loss, trust, and the search for identity.
Cinematic Elements
The film is shot with an emphasis on moody and atmospheric visuals that complement the story's introspective nature. The rural settings evoke a sense of isolation, amplifying the emotional state of the characters. The cinematography uses shadows and natural lighting effectively to mirror the internal struggle of Jack and Harper.
The sound design and musical score are subtly integrated, creating an immersive experience without overpowering the narrative. Unlike Bollywood films, which often incorporate elaborate song and dance sequences, "Detour" maintains a more restrained approach appropriate to its Hollywood drama roots. Consequently, the musical elements serve to underscore the tone rather than divert attention.
